Understanding the Relevance of CPR
Why is CPR Crucial?
The key objective of doing CPR is to keep blood circulation and oxygenation to essential organs, especially the mind. When a person's heart stops, they might lose consciousness within secs, and mental retardation can occur within mins without blood circulation. Hence, instant activity through CPR can save a life.

Basic Components of CPR
1. Analyzing the Situation
Before you start administering m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, guarantee it's secure for both you and the sufferer. Seek indicators of responsiveness. If they're unresponsive and not breathing (or only gasping), it's time to act.
2. Calling for Help
Call emergency services promptly or ask somebody else to do so while you begin carrying out care.
3. Starting Upper Body Compressions
- Place your turn over the center of the chest. Use your body weight to compress down hard and fast at a rate of 100-120 compressions per minute. Ensure that each compression has to do with 2 inches deep but not greater than 2.4 inches; this helps stay clear of incorrect compression depth.
4. Offering Rescue Breaths (if educated)
If you're learnt rescue breaths:
- Give 30 chest compressions complied with by 2 rescue breaths. Ensure each breath lasts concerning one 2nd and makes the chest increase visibly.
Using an AED: Just How to Make use of It
An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is an important tool that can restore a normal heart rhythm during heart attack:
Turn on the AED. Follow audio/visual prompts. Attach pads as shown on the device. Allow it to evaluate heart rhythm and follow instructions accordingly.CPR for Different Age Groups

What needs to I do if I'm unclear concerning supplying rescue breaths?
If you're uncomfortable providing rescue breaths, emphasis solely on breast compressions till assistance arrives; this is still really effective!
Can I make use of an AED on myself if I'm unconscious?
No! AEDs are developed for use on others only; constantly seek assistance from a person nearby if incapacitated.

Is it lawful to do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ation if I'm not certified?
Yes! Good Samaritan laws commonly shield individuals who provide help during emergencies as long as actions are sensible given their level of training!
